
In an enforcement action under the zero-tolerance policy of the Gurugram police towards corruption, the SHO of the Women Police Station, Manesar, has been transferred to Police Lines due to lack of supervision in a bribery case involving a female Head Constable.
According to the police, on June 12, Head Constable Kavita, who was posted at the Women Police Station in Manesar, was caught red-handed by the Anti-Corruption Bureau (ACB) while accepting a bribe of Rs 50,000.
In view of the seriousness of the matter, the Gurugram police transferred the SHO of the Women Police Station Manesar to Police Lines with immediate effect and initiated a departmental inquiry/action against her for a lack of supervision.
